In
the next few pages of the novel, the author provides a brief
description of Precious. She was born on November 4, 1970, and when
she has her first child she is twelve years old. However, the book
flashes back from the time she is twelve until the present day, she
is now sixteen. She is heavyset for her age, weighing over two
hundred pounds. She is also very dark skinned. The author also
mentions that the kids at school make fun of her. “Claireece is so
ugly she lagging ugly”, one kid remarks. (12) Her mother is named
Mary L. Johnston, who is mentioned as being much larger and uglier
than Precious. She is cruel to Precious and blames her for “sleeping
with her husband.” Precious father is named Carl Kenwood Jones.
Precious and her mother live in the Bronx. Carl is not married to
Mary, despite the fact she considers him “husband”. Carl only
comes around to rape his daughter, and then has sex with Precious
mother. Precious first child is named Mongoloid, commonly referred to
as “Mongo” or “Little Mongo”, because she is named after the
down syndrome she has. Precious says “Baby’s face is smashed flat
like pancake, eyes is all slanted up like Koreans, tongue goin ‘ in
‘n out like some kinda snake.” (17) It is hinted that the child
suffered from oxygen deprivation at birth, which probably could have been prevented if Precious had proper prenatal care. Her mother knew
about the pregnant child and did not try to take her to a doctor.
Also, the incest probably led to the development of the child, but
Precious also never saw a doctor during her pregnancy. However, it
is a blessing that the child remained alive.
